body {
	margin:0;
	color:#000;
	font: 12px  Arial, Tahoma, Verdana, Helvetica, sans-serif;
	background:#f2f2f2 url(../images/bg-page.gif) repeat-y 50% 0;
	min-width:988px;
	border-top-style: solid;
	border-right-style: solid;
	border-bottom-style: solid;
	border-left-style: solid;
}
form,fieldset{
	margin:0;
	padding:0;
	border-style:none;
}
img {
	border:0;
	margin:0;
}
a{
	text-decoration:none;
	color:#FFFFFF;
}
a:hover{text-decoration:underline;}
/*home start*/
.wrap{
	width:100%;
	overflow:hidden;
}
#header {
	width:100%;
	background: url(../images/bg-header.gif) repeat-x;
}
#header .header-area {
	margin:0 auto;
	height:86px;
	background: url(../images/header-area.gif) no-repeat 50% 0;
}
#header .header-content {
	margin:0 auto;
	padding:18px 15px 0 14px;
	width:931px;
	height:68px;
	background: url(../images/header-content.gif) repeat-x;
}
#header .header-content  h1.logo{
	float: left;
	width: 119px;
	height: 29px;
	background: url(../images/logo.gif) no-repeat;
	text-indent: -9999px;
	overflow: hidden;
	margin:0;
}
#header .header-content  h1.logo a{
	display:block;
	width: 119px;
	height: 29px;
} 
#header .header-content em{
	background: url(../images/AUK.gif) no-repeat;
	width:347px;
	height:19px;
	text-indent: -9999px;
	overflow: hidden;
	float: left;
	margin:6px 0 0 12px;
}
#header .form{
	background: url(../images/bg-form.gif) no-repeat;
	height:23px;
	padding: 4px 4px 0 12px;
	width:212px;
	float:right;
}
#header .form div{
	float:left;
	width:180px;
}
#header .form .img{float:right;}
#header .form input.text{
	border:0;
	background:none;
	margin:0 5px 0 0;
	padding:2px 1px 0 1px;
	width:190px;
	height:13px;
	font-size:11px;
	color:#b3b3b3;
}
#header .header-content .navigation{
	width:960px;
	margin: 0;
	padding: 19px 0 5px;
	list-style: none;
	float:left;
}
#header .header-content .navigation li {
	float: left;
	padding:0 16px;
	height:20px;
}
#header .header-content .navigation li a{
	font-size:11px;
	font-weight:bold;
	height:20px;
	display:block;
	float: left;
}
#header .header-content .navigation  a:hover{
	background: url(../images/icon-active.gif) no-repeat 50% 100%;
	color:#fee2a1;
	overflow:hidden;
	text-decoration:none;
}
#header .header-content .navigation li.active a{
	background: url(../images/icon-active.gif) no-repeat 50% 100%;
	color:#fee2a1;
	overflow:hidden;
}
#content {
	width:960px;
	padding:0 12px;
	margin:0 auto;
	background: url(../images/bg-content.gif) repeat-y;
}
#content .top-content{
	overflow:hidden;
	background: url(../images/bg-degree.gif) repeat-y;
	width:960px;
}
#content .top-content .degree{
	background:url(../images/top-content.gif) no-repeat 0 100%;
	width:960px;
	overflow:hidden;
}
#content .top-content .degree-top{
	float:left;
	width:277px;
	background: url(../images/degree-top.gif) no-repeat 0 0;
	padding:73px 10px 0 23px;
	overflow:hidden;
}
#content .degree-top h3{
	margin:0 0 16px -2px;
	color:#06254f;
	font-size: 14px;
}
#content .degree-top p{
	margin:0;
	font-size:11px;
	color:#666;
	line-height:17px;
}
#content .degree-top a{
	color:#84171a;
	font-size:11px;
}
#content .more{
	background: url(../images/icon-more.gif) no-repeat 0 13px;
	padding:10px 0 0 10px;
	float:left;
	margin:0 30px 0 0;
}
#content .moreblog{
	padding:10px 0 0 10px;
	float:left;
	margin:0 30px 0 0;
}
#content span.more a{
	font-weight:bold;
	color:#84171a;
	font-size:11px;
}
#content .degree-top img{
	display:block;
	border:1px solid #ccc;
	margin:0 0 12px -2px;
}
#content .top-content .photo{
	float:right;
	width:295px;
	background: url(../images/photo.jpg) no-repeat;
	padding:0 0 0 355px;
}
#content .photo .shade{
	background: url(../images/shade.png) repeat;
	width:250px;
	overflow:hidden;
	padding-top: 16px;
	padding-right: 22px;
	padding-bottom: 10px;
	padding-left: 23px;
}
#content .photo .shade h3{
	margin:0 0 5px;
	color:#7a7777;
	font-weight:bold;
	font: 12px 'Times New Roman', Times, Georgia, serif;
}
#content .photo .shade h2{
	margin:0;
	font: 22px/30px Georgia, 'Times New Roman', Times,  serif;
	font-weight:bold;
	color:#fff;
}
#content .photo .shade p{
	margin:0 0 5px;
	font-size:11px;
	line-height:25px;
	color:#fff;
}
#content .photo .shade span a{
	color:#fdeec5;
	font-size:11px;
	font-weight:bold;
}
#content .photo .shade span{
	background: url(../images/icon-more2.gif) no-repeat 0 50%;
	padding:0 0 0 10px;
	display:block;
	margin:0 0 0 160px;
}
#content .photo .shade .arrow{
	background: url(../images/arrow.gif) no-repeat 0 50%;
	text-indent:-9999px;
	overflow:hidden;
	float:right;
	width:22px;
	height:24px;
	margin:17px -15px 0 0;
}
#content .content-area {
	overflow:hidden;
	margin:0 auto;
	width:960px;
}
#content .content-area .information{
	float:left;
	width:270px;
	padding:20px 5px 0 25px;
}
#content .information .apply{padding:0 0 20px 40px;}
#content .information .apply p{
	margin:0 0 15px;
	font-size:11px;
	font-weight:bold;
	color:#84171a;
}
#content .information .apply img{display:block;}
#content .apply .btn-apply{
	background: url(../images/btn-apply.gif) no-repeat;
	width:177px;
	height:34px;
	overflow:hidden;
	text-indent:-9999px;
	display:block;
	margin:0 0 15px;
}
#content .apply .btn-virtual{
	background: url(../images/btn-virtual.gif) no-repeat;
	width:177px;
	height:34px;
	text-indent:-9999px;
	display:block;
	margin:0 0 15px;
}
#content .education{	padding:0 0 45px 0;}
#content .education h3{
	margin:0 0 10px;
	color:#bd8911;
	font-size:12px;
	font-weight:bold;
}
#content .education p{
	margin:0;
	color:#7a7a7a;
	font-size:11px;
	line-height:18px;
}
#content .information .spotlight{
	width:270px;
	overflow:hidden;
}
#content .spotlight h3{
	margin:0;
	color:#bd8911;
	font-size:14px;
	font-weight:bold;
}
#content .spotlight img{
	border:1px solid #cdccc8;
	float:left;
	margin:20px 0 0;
}
#content .spotlight .info{
	float:right;
	width:186px;
	padding:15px 0 0;
}
#content .spotlight .info strong{
	color:#15578b;
	font-size:13px;
	font-weight:bold;
}
#content .spotlight .info em{color:#3c3426;}
#content .spotlight .info p{
	margin:3px 0 10px;
	color:#8c8c8c;
	font-weight:bold;
	font-size:11px;
}
#content .information .form{
	width:245px;
	overflow:hidden;
	padding:10px 0 18px;
}
#content .form  a{
	background: url(../images/btn-rss.gif) no-repeat;
	float:left;
	width:37px;
	height:18px;
	overflow:hidden;
	text-indent:-9999px;
	margin:0 0 10px;
}
#content .information .form select {
	width:240px;
	border:1px solid #91adc5;
	font-size:13px;
	color:#342400;
	padding:0 3px;
	background-color:#f5f5f5;
	float:left;
	margin:0 0 0 5px;
}

#footer .footer-content select {
	width:240px;
	border:1px solid #91adc5;
	font-size:13px;
	color:#342400;
	padding:0 3px;
	background-color:#f5f5f5;
}
#content .events{
	width:650px;
	float:right;
	background-color:#fff;
	overflow:hidden;
}
#content .news{
	padding:25px 26px 26px 20px;
	width:604px;
	overflow:hidden;
}
#content .news h2{
	margin:0;
	background: url(../images/news-events.gif) no-repeat;
	overflow:hidden;
	text-indent:-9999px;
	width:260px;
	height:21px;
}
#content .news-box{
	width:604px;
	padding:24px 0 0;
}
#content .news-box h3{
	margin:0 0 12px;
	color:#06254f;
	font-size: 18px;
	font-weight:bold;
}
#content .news p{
	margin:0 0 10px;
	line-height:20px;
}
#content .news span a{
	color:#84171a;
	font-size:11px;
	font-weight:bold;
}
#content .news span{
	background: url(../images/icon-more.gif) no-repeat 0 13px;
	padding:10px 0 0 10px;
}
#content .news p.holder{
	margin:0;
	overflow:hidden;
	width:604px;
}
#content .news .btn-news{
	background: url(../images/btn-news.gif) no-repeat;
	width:147px;
	height:29px;
	overflow:hidden;
	text-indent:-9999px;
	float:right;
}
#content .news p.holder span{float:left;}
#content .upcoming{
	background: #ffeec6 url(../images/upcoming.gif) repeat-x;
	padding:10px 15px 15px 20px;
	width:615px;
	overflow:hidden;
}
#content .upcoming-holder{
overflow:hidden;
	padding:32px 0 5px;
}
#content .upcoming h3{
	margin:0;
	color:#fff;
	font-size:14px;
	font-weight:bold;
}
#content .upcoming .see{
	float:left;
	width:198px;
}
#content  .see img{
	border:1px solid #bac2c4;
	float:left;
	margin:0 0 15px;
}
#content  .see span a{
	color:#84171a;
	font-size:11px;
	font-weight:bold;
}
#content  .see span{
	background: url(../images/icon-more.gif) no-repeat 0 13px;
	padding:10px 0 0 10px;
}
#content .upcoming .list{
	float:right;
	width:378px;
	padding:0 0 0 8px;
}
#content .list .btn-make{
	background: url(../images/btn-make.gif) no-repeat;
	width:146px;
	height:29px;
	overflow:hidden;
	text-indent:-9999px;
	float:right;
}
#content .upcoming .list ul{
	margin:0;
	padding:0 0 10px 0;
	list-style:none;
}
#content .upcoming .list ul li{
	padding:0 0 18px 15px;
	background: url(../images/icon-list.gif) no-repeat 0 7px;
	font: 12px 'Times New Roman', Times, Georgia, serif;
}
#content .upcoming .list ul strong{
	color:#b88100;
	font-size:14px;
}
#content .upcoming .list ul p{
	margin:0;
	color:#4a412d;
	line-height:16px;
}
#footer {width:100%;}
#footer .footer-main {
	width:100%;
	margin:0 auto;
	background: #001c41 url(../images/bg-footer-main.gif) repeat-x;
}
#footer .footer-top {
	width:100%;
	margin:0 auto;
	background: url(../images/footer-top.gif) repeat-y 50% 0;
}
#footer .footer-area {
	width:100%;
	margin:0 auto;
	background: url(../images/footer-area.gif) no-repeat 50% 0;
}
#footer .footer-content {
	width:910px;
	overflow:hidden;
	margin:0 auto;
	background: #001c41 url(../images/footer-content.gif) repeat-x;
	padding:0 25px 0 25px;
	clear:both;
}
#footer .footer-content .navigation{
	margin: 0;
	padding: 5px 0;
	list-style: none;
	float:right;
}
#footer .footer-content .navigation li {
	float: left;
	padding:0 0 0 22px;
}
#footer .navigation li a{
	font-size:11px;
	font-weight:bold;
}
#footer .holder-footer{
	overflow:hidden;
	width:860px;
	float:left;
	padding:10px 0 13px 50px;
}
#footer .holder-footer img{
	float:left;
	margin:20px 0 0;
}
#footer .adress{
	float:left;
	padding:20px 0 0 60px;
}
#footer .adress p{
	margin:0 0 2px 0;
	color:#185783;
	font-size:11px;
	font-weight:bold;
}
#footer .adress a{color:#185783;}
#footer .links-list{	
	float:right;
	width:210px;
	overflow:hidden;
	padding:0 2px 0 0;
}
#footer .links-list ul{
	margin:0;
	padding:0 0 12px;
	list-style:none;
	float:right;
}
#footer .links-list ul li{
	display:inline;
	padding:0 0 0 20px;
}
#footer .links-list ul li a{
	color:#616163;
	font-size:11px;
	font-weight:bold;
}
#footer .links-list img{margin:0 0 0 75px;}
#footer .links-list a.pay{
	float:right;
	width:43px;
	height:14px;
	text-indent:-9999px;
	overflow:hidden;
	background: url(../images/pay.gif) no-repeat;
}
#footer .links-list p em{color:#2997d8;}
#footer .footer-banners{
	width:960px;
	height:37px;
	margin:0 auto;
	background-color:#fff;
	padding:5px 0 0;
}
#footer .footer-banners ul{
	margin:0;
	padding:0;
	list-style:none;
	text-align:center;
}
#footer .footer-banners ul li{
	display:inline;
	padding:0 5px;
}
/*home end*/
/*inner start*/
#content-inner {
	width:960px;
	padding:0 12px;
	margin:0 auto;
	background: url(../images/bg-content-inner.gif) repeat-y;
	overflow:hidden;
}
/*#content-inner :after{
	content:"";
	display:block;
	clear:both;
	height:0;
}*/
#content-inner .side-bar{
	width:160px;
	float:left;
}
#content-inner .side-nav{
	width:160px;
	background: url(../images/side-bar.gif) no-repeat;
	padding-top: 95px;
	padding-right: 0;
	padding-bottom: 0;
	padding-left: 0;
	overflow: visible;
	min-height: 346px;
}
#content-inner .side-bar ul{
	margin:0;
	padding:0 0 24px;
	list-style:none;
	/*background: url(../images/side-bar-border.gif) no-repeat 0 100%;*/
	width:260px;
}
#content-inner .side-bar ul li{
	text-align:right;
	float:left;
	width:160px;
}
#content-inner .side-bar ul li a{
	color:#000;
	display:block;
	padding:11px 34px 0 0;
	font: bold 11px/18px  Tahoma, Arial, sans-serif;
	height:30px;
	position:relative;
}
#content-inner .side-bar ul li a:hover{
	background: url(../images/linka.gif) no-repeat;
	margin:0 0 0 -11px;
	text-decoration:none;
	font-size:11px;
}
#content-inner .side-bar ul li.active a{
	background: url(../images/linka.gif) no-repeat;
	margin:0 0 0 -11px;
	text-decoration:none;
	font-size:11px;
}
#content-inner .side-bar .apply {padding:25px 0 20px 40px;}
#content-inner .side-bar .apply span{
	background: url(../images/icon-more.gif) no-repeat 0 3px;
	padding:0 0 0 12px;
}
#content-inner .side-bar .apply span a{
	font-size:11px;
	font-weight:bold;
	color:#84171a;
}
#content-inner .apply img{
	display:block;
	margin:35px 0 15px 15px;
}
#content-inner .apply .btn-apply{
	background: url(../images/btn-apply-inner.gif) no-repeat;
	width:177px;
	height:34px;
	overflow:hidden;
	text-indent:-9999px;
	display:block;
	margin:0 0 10px;
}
#content-inner .spotlight{
	width:222px;
	overflow:hidden;
	padding:0 20px 200px 18px;
}
#content-inner .spotlight h3{
	margin:0;
	color:#bd8911;
	font-size:14px;
	font-weight:bold;
}
#content-inner .spotlight img{
	border:1px solid #cdccc8;
	float:left;
	margin:10px 0 0;
}
#content-inner .spotlight .info{
	float:right;
	width:148px;
	padding:8px 0 0;
}
#content-inner .spotlight .info strong{
	color:#15578b;
	font-size:13px;
	font-weight:bold;
}
#content-innert .spotlight .info em{color:#3c3426;}
#content-inner .spotlight .info p{
	margin:3px 0 10px;
	color:#8c8c8c;
	font-weight:bold;
	font-size:12px;
}
#content-inner .form{
	width:235px;
	overflow:hidden;
	padding:10px 0 18px 14px;
}
#content-inner .form  a{
	background: url(../images/btn-rss.gif) no-repeat;
	float:left;
	width:37px;
	height:18px;
	overflow:hidden;
	text-indent:-9999px;
	margin:0 0 8px;
}
#content-inner .form select,
.footer-content .form select {
	width:235px;
	border:1px solid #91adc5;
	font-size:13px;
	color:#342400;
	padding:0 3px;
	background-color:#f5f5f5;
}
#content-inner .text-box{
	width:900px;
	float:right;
	padding:26px 30px 0 20px;
	overflow:hidden;
}
#content-inner .text-box h2{
	margin:0 0 24px;
	border-bottom:1px solid #ccc;
	color:#831b1c;
	font: bold 21px  Verdana, Tahoma, Arial,   Helvetica, sans-serif;
	letter-spacing:1px;
}
#content-inner .text-box h3{
	margin:0 0 12px;
	color:#06254f;
	font-size: 19px;
	font-weight:bold;
}
#content-inner .text-holder {
	overflow:hidden;
	width:900px;
}
#content-inner .text-holder img{
	border:1px solid #cdcdcd;
	float:left;
	margin-top: 0;
	margin-right: 0;
	margin-bottom: 15px;
	margin-left: 0px;
}
#content-inner .text-box p {
	float: none;
	margin:0 0 22px;
	font: 12px/18px Tahoma, Arial, sans-serif;
}
#content-inner .text-box .p-1 {text-align: justify;}
/*inner end*/#link {
	font-size: 12px;
	font-weight: bold;
	color: #84171A;
}
#content-inner .link {
	color: #831B1C;
}

#content-inner .text-box .text-holder li {
	font-family: Tahoma, Arial, sans-serif;
	font-size: 12px;
	line-height: 16px;
}
#content_blog a {
	color: #831B1C;
}
table.tdi {
	border-width: 1px;
	border-spacing: 0px;
	border-color: #FF9933;
	border-collapse: separate;
	background-color: #FFFFCC;
}
table.tdi th {
	border-width: 1px;
	padding: 1px;
	border-style: inset;
	border-color: #FF9933;
	background-color: #FFFFCC;
	-moz-border-radius: ;
}